Abstract

A labeling part 3 analyzes the character string data to produce a phoneme label and a prosody label, partition the voice data stored in a voice database 1 into phonemic data, and label the phonemic data, employing the phoneme label and the like. A phoneme segmenting part 4 connects the voice data labeled with the same kind of phonemic data, and a formant extracting part 5 specifies the frequency of formant of each piece of phonemic data. A processing part 6 decides an evaluation value for each phonemic data based on the frequency of formant, and an error detection part 7 detects the phonemic data of which a deviation of the evaluation value within a set of phonemic data reaches a predetermined amount.

Claims (79)

1. A voice labeling error detecting system comprising:

data acquisition means for acquiring waveform data representing a waveform of a unit voice and labeling data for identifying a kind of said unit voice;

classification means for classifying the waveform data acquired by said data acquisition means into the kinds of unit voice, based on the labeling data acquired by said data acquisition means;

evaluation value decision means for specifying a frequency of a formant of each unit voice represented by the waveform data acquired by said data acquisition means and determining an evaluation value of said waveform data based on the specified frequency; and

error detection means for detecting the waveform data from among a set of waveform data classified into a same kind, for which a deviation of evaluation value within said set reaches a predetermined amount, and outputting the data representing said detected waveform data, as waveform data having a labeling error, and

2. The voice labeling error detecting system according to claim 1 , characterized in that said evaluation value is a linear combination of plural frequencies of formants in a spectrum of acquired waveform data.

3. The voice labeling error detecting system according to claim 1 or 2 , characterized in that said evaluation value deciding means deals with a frequency at a maximal value of a spectrum in the waveform data as the frequency of formant of unit voice indicated by said waveform data.
